Transaction 059fbc4b8cca4237c5a112d90780a64a705397f7cabe4a303c01ac019052956c

1 Input
1 Outputs
  • 059fbc4b8cca4237c5a112d90780a64a705397f7cabe4a303c01ac019052956c:0
  • value  878736
    address  3MSxjo3cGgPvX9vXn56Hvi6twsdFAp6uN8